WOMEN’S HEALTH PRESENTS "ARE YOU GAME?" TOMORROW

 

OUTDOOR SUMMER FESTIVAL IN NYC ON JULY 11TH

 

-- Free Summer Festival to Feature Euro Bungee, Rock Climbing Wall, Virtual Surfing, Workout Classes, Beauty & Spa Treatments, Fashion Shows, Karaoke and More --

 

WHAT: Women’s Health’s annual summer festival, Are You Game?, is returning to New York for the third year.  Building on the success of last year’s events in New York and Chicago, which were attended by more than 4,000 people, Are You Game? will allow urban women to experience the ultimate in outdoor fun and adventure. Are You Game? will be open to the public at no cost and will offer a host of fun and athletic challenges and activities, such as:

 

  • Euro Bungee

  • Rock Climbing

  • Beauty and Spa Treatments

  • Workout Classes including: Masala Bhangra, Million Dollar Knockout, Hula Hoop Pilates, and more!

  • Virtual Surfing

  • Fashion Shows

  • Karaoke

  • Happy Hour

  • And MUCH MORE for the thousands of expected visitors!

 

WHEN:             SATURDAY, July 11th, 2009

                         FROM 10 AM – 5 PM

 

WHERE:          Manhattan’s Hudson River Park at Pier 46

                         (Charles Street and West Street)

 

WHO:              Women’s Health presents Are You Game? along with the following sponsors: American Laser Centers, ASICS, Champion, Edy’s, Garnier, Heartland Brewery, Maybelline New York, Oakley, and Subaru of America, Inc.

 

As the official spa partner for the event, Oasis Day Spa will provide all spa and beauty services for the “Workout to Knockout” pavilion, while Crunch, the official gym partner for Are You Game?, will instruct all the workout classes.

 

As the official beneficiary of the event, Susan G. Komen for the Cure will host a donation station where attendees will have the opportunity to make a donation.
